Transaction 62381d72af37369a84a6bc8a5fdbad53dfc01c2146ec70b4d41e1fa8baa4cad0

2 Input
2 Outputs
  • 62381d72af37369a84a6bc8a5fdbad53dfc01c2146ec70b4d41e1fa8baa4cad0:0
  • value  504143
    address  18whBNMgn9sjZ2gVHyVCJMmxW6rVMPYwv2
  • 62381d72af37369a84a6bc8a5fdbad53dfc01c2146ec70b4d41e1fa8baa4cad0:1
  • value  3020000
    address  3B1FUGiJBx3jGXUjSazsFec1jyzyFR1xzR